Cyclops Blink Evolves Into x86-64 Linux Implant With Packet Sniffing and Internal Network Scanning

Sophos uncovers a new x86-64 Cyclops Blink Linux implant with packet sniffing and internal network scanning on compromised Cisco FMC appliances.

Sophos identified a 64-bit Linux Cyclops Blink implant in August on compromised Cisco Firewall Management Center devices, persisting via SysV init scripts and masquerading as the process 'kworker01'. The modular malware runs five child processes for reconnaissance, file transfer, scanning, packet capture, and persistence, and beacons hourly over outbound TLS to hardcoded C2 89.34.96.56 on ports 43856 and 49172. The family was previously tied to Russian-linked Sandworm activity on WatchGuard appliances, though Sophos treats 2026 attribution cautiously. The packet-capture module applies configurable filters to retain credentials, cookies, and authentication tokens from raw Ethernet traffic.

Schneider Electric SCADAPack x70 Products

CISA advisory: Schneider Electric SCADAPack x70 RTUs contain CVE-2026-81861, an insufficiently protected credentials flaw allowing unauthorized access to RTU configuration.

CISA advisory ICSA-26-258-04 discloses CVE-2026-81861 affecting all versions of Schneider Electric SCADAPack 47x, 47xi, 47xd, 470R, 57x, 3xx, and 32 remote terminal units. The CWE-522 insufficiently protected credentials vulnerability could expose authentication information and permit unauthorized access to RTU configuration through the Secure Lock functionality. The flaw carries a CVSS v3.1 base score of 6.5 (medium), and the products are deployed worldwide in critical manufacturing and energy sectors. Abhinav Agarwal reported the vulnerability to CISA.

Sakana AI Researchers Introduce PC-ALM, a Layer-Local Alternative to Backpropagation That Trains 1000-Layer Networks

Sakana AI's PC-ALM adds per-layer Lagrange multipliers to predictive coding, matching backprop on networks up to 1000 layers with layer-local updates.

Sakana AI researchers propose Augmented Lagrangian Predictive Coding (PC-ALM), a training method that keeps every update layer-local while recovering backprop-aligned credit signals. The team proves multipliers converge to exact backprop adjoints in linear networks and trains 1000-layer residual MLPs on MNIST within about 2 points of backprop accuracy. PC-ALM matched backprop across a width/depth grid from 8 to 128 on MNIST and Fashion-MNIST where standard predictive coding failed in deep, narrow networks, and improved over PC on ResNet-18 with CIFAR-10 and Tiny ImageNet. An MIT-licensed JAX reference implementation reproduces the results on CPU.

The sexy AI-powered dating app scams are here

Anthropic exposed a network of roughly 28 AI-driven dating apps using autonomous personas and gig workers to defraud paying users.

Anthropic threat intelligence uncovered a fraud network of around 28 dating apps after a prepaid account sent over 100,000 Claude API requests daily, with most chats run by autonomous AI personas and no human agent. Researchers Matthew Gore-Kormanik and Anthropic's Chris Cronbaugh documented apps including Dora, Romi, and Doni, which monetize conversations via coins; gig workers were hired only to pass liveness checks and select pregenerated replies. An operations manual written in Chinese was found inside the Doni app, and Anthropic published findings in its September 2026 AI misuse report.

Palo Alto PAN-OS Buffer Overflow Lets Attackers Execute Arbitrary Code as Root

Palo Alto Networks fixed CVE-2026-0310, a CVSS 9.2 unauthenticated PAN-OS buffer overflow enabling root code execution on PA-Series firewalls.

Palo Alto Networks published an advisory on September 9, 2026 for CVE-2026-0310, a CWE-787 out-of-bounds write in PAN-OS XML processing with a CVSS v4.0 base score of 9.2, affecting the management and dataplane interfaces. Unauthenticated attackers could execute arbitrary code as root on PA-Series hardware firewalls, while VM-Series faces denial-of-service impact and Prisma Access and Cloud NGFW have reduced, authenticated exposure. Affected releases include PAN-OS 10.2, 11.1, 11.2, 12.1, and 12.2 before fixed maintenance releases such as 12.2.3, 12.1.4-h10, 11.2.13-h2, 11.1.16-h2, and 10.2.18-h10; no workaround is available. Palo Alto is not aware of malicious exploitation but classifies remediation urgency as highest.

CareCam CM2507

CISA advisory: seven flaws in CareCam CM2507 IP cameras enable unauthenticated live video access, privileged ONVIF control, credential recovery, and code execution.

CISA advisory ICSA-26-258-08 discloses seven vulnerabilities in CareCam HMT.CM2507 IP cameras running firmware v251211.1507. Issues include missing authentication for network video streaming (CVE-2026-88259, CVSS 3.1 7.5), an empty password on a privileged ONVIF account (CVE-2026-84398), weak legacy hashing of the root password (CVE-2026-85497, CVSS 4.0 9.3 critical), and cleartext storage of Wi-Fi credentials (CVE-2026-81321). Physical-access flaws allow arbitrary code execution from scripts on removable media (CVE-2026-81305) and unauthenticated bootloader access (CVE-2026-85478). The cameras are deployed worldwide in commercial facilities.

Getting a stranger’s phone kicked off the cellular network costs a few dollars

Researchers show attackers can remotely block strangers' phones and alarm gateways on US cellular networks by abusing lost/stolen IMEI reporting for $2.50-$4 per device.

Researchers from Michigan State University and three partner schools found six weaknesses in the lost/stolen device reporting ecosystem spanning devices, carrier systems, and cross-carrier block-list sharing. They demonstrated blocking unopened Samsung Galaxy Z Fold 7 phones and home alarm gateways on three major US carriers, with each block costing $2.50-$4 and taking roughly 20-80 seconds. The attacks exploit thin identity and ownership checks in prepaid accounts, IMEI leakage from vulnerable cellular chipsets used by two vendors with over 40% global market share, and pre-release IMEI databases purchasable for $600. Victims receive no notification, and restoring service requires proving device ownership to the carrier.

TP-Link Cameras 0-Day Vulnerabilities Allow Attackers to Spy on Users

Two zero-day flaws in TP-Link Tapo C200 cameras allowed authentication bypass and denial-of-service; fixed in firmware V5_1.4.6.

OPSWAT researchers Khoi Tran and Thai Do found CVE-2026-15315, an authentication bypass in the Tapo C200's local HTTPS interface that lets network-adjacent attackers replay an authentication value to gain administrator access, and CVE-2026-15316, an unauthenticated denial-of-service in the Wi-Fi onboarding process that crashes the camera's HTTPS service. TP-Link was notified on April 16, 2026, confirmed the flaws on July 10, and released patches on August 18, 2026 in firmware V5_1.4.6. Exploitation requires local network access but no valid account, existing session, or user interaction, exposing live feeds and stored recordings to surveillance risk.

Turn it off and on again, but for critical infrastructure

KTH researchers trained a reinforcement-learning intrusion response agent on an emulated segmented OT network that autonomously resets hosts and processes to disrupt intruders.

Researchers at KTH Royal Institute of Technology built a containerized replica of a segmented industrial network, attacked it across 14 days, and captured 40,000 30-second traffic intervals to train a defense agent under partial observability. The agent observes six packet-count numbers per interval, maintains 500 running state hypotheses, and can reset supervisory hosts, water tank processes, or entire subnets, with resets rebooting the target, renewing credentials, and changing its IP. The best agent approached a full-visibility baseline but depends on an assumed attacker behavior model; the testbed comprised three supervisory hosts, two PLCs, two tanks, weak credentials, and CVE-2017-7494 exposure. The team released its implementation and plans validation on a real industrial testbed with a partner.

New KATARU IoT Malware Packs Linux Privilege Escalation Exploits and Mirai-Style DDoS Attacks

Nozomi Networks identified KATARU, a new Mirai-style IoT botnet delivered via Telnet brute force that uses Linux privilege-escalation exploits and encrypted C2 for DDoS floods.

Nozomi Networks identified KATARU in August after a Telnet password-guessing attack against a honeypot retrieved an ARM payload. The malware attempts exploits for CVE-2026-46300 (Fragnesia), CVE-2026-43284 (DirtyFrag), and CVE-2026-31431 (Copy Fail), plus a cgroup v1 release_agent escape, and persists via systemd services, cron tasks, rc scripts, OpenWrt hooks, and Android boot locations. Its C2 uses X25519 key exchange with ChaCha20-Poly1305 encryption and supports TCP, UDP, ICMP, HTTP, QUIC, and DNS floods, plus SSH brute forcing and command execution; embedded exploit shellcode in the ARM build targeted x86, suggesting untested copied code.

Redtail Payload Analysis [Guest Diary], (Wed, Sep 9th)

SANS guest analyst detonated a RedTail Linux sample from a DShield honeypot, finding process masquerading as php-fpm, monitoring-kill behavior, and a TCP listener.

A DShield honeypot captured multi-architecture RedTail Linux executables (ARM, ARM64, i686, RISC-V, x86-64) deployed via shell scripts. Dynamic analysis of the UPX-packed, statically linked x86-64 sample (SHA-256 63be5f38...d35e) in an isolated Ubuntu 24.04 VM on Proxmox showed it renamed its process via prctl(PR_SET_NAME), killed a filesystem-monitoring process, and opened a TCP listening socket while surviving processes posed as php-fpm or PostgreSQL-like workers. Differential memory images pre- and post-execution were captured from the hypervisor for forensics.

Hackers Can Rent VectraRAT for $250 a Month to Take Control of Windows PCs

SOCRadar uncovered VectraRAT, a previously undocumented $250-per-month Windows RAT rental service delivered via Amadey and ClickFix lures.

SOCRadar's Threat Research Unit identified VectraRAT, a rental-only remote access trojan sold by a developer known as Vectra (formerly Nyxel), after an exposed online directory revealed samples, licenses, and operator logs across ten-plus servers. The toolkit includes a Linux control server, Windows implant, payload builder, and VectraHub panel, enabling hidden desktop access, keylogging, command execution, credential theft, file transfer, proxying, and silent privilege escalation. Of victims with OS data, 48 percent ran corporate Windows editions, and researchers recorded 38 genuine victim sessions in under a week, including file theft from business systems. Distribution occurs through the Amadey loader and ClickFix pages impersonating TurboTax, with custom TCP-based C2 over non-standard ports.

MacOS 27 - First Boot, (Tue, Sep 15th)

SANS ISC documents the expected network traffic macOS 27 'Golden Gate' generates on first boot to help defenders baseline their networks.

Johannes Ullrich of SANS Internet Storm Center captured roughly 300 packets from a macOS 27 'Golden Gate' system before user login, covering DHCP, IPv6 duplicate address discovery, DNS, and TCP behavior. macOS 27 resolves hostnames like albert.apple.com (device activation, certificate-pinned), push messaging hosts, and ipv4only.arpa for NAT64 networks. The OS still uses a TCP window scale of 6, ECN, and random timestamps, with only four TCP connections observed during boot. The analysis provides a reference baseline for security teams monitoring Apple endpoints.

Non-Zero-Day VPN Flaw Left Japan ‘s Government Shared Network Platform Exposed: 246,000 Records at Risk

Japan's Digital Agency says attackers exploited a patchable VPN flaw to access a government shared platform, exposing records of ~246,000 employees across 23 ministries.

Japan's Digital Agency disclosed that attackers exploited a medium-severity, already-patchable vulnerability in a VPN device to access the Government Solution Service (GSS), potentially leaking personal data of roughly 246,000 government employees, officials, and contractors across 23 ministries. The intrusion was detected on June 25 and confirmed as VPN exploitation on July 9, with public disclosure 78 days after detection. Exposed data includes about 236,000 names, 231,000 email addresses, 94,000 phone numbers, and 1,000 physical addresses; no My Number, bank account, or pension numbers were included. The compromised maintenance staff account was suspended and the compromised hardware isolated, but the VPN product and flaw were not disclosed.

Operation RapidRust: APT36 Deploys RUSTYSHADE, RUSTYMOVE, PSNATCH, and BASHNATCH

Zscaler details Operation RapidRust: APT36 deploys four new tools including RUSTYSHADE, a Rust backdoor using private GitHub repos for encrypted C2.

Zscaler ThreatLabz documents Operation RapidRust, a campaign by Pakistan-aligned APT36 deploying four new tools: RUSTYSHADE, a 64-bit Rust Windows backdoor that uses attacker-controlled private GitHub repositories with a hardcoded PAT and AES-256-GCM-encrypted messages for C2; RUSTYMOVE; PSNATCH, a PowerShell file stealer that scans Office documents, archives, media, and databases modified in the last 120 days and exfiltrates up to 5 GB per run to per-machine GitHub repositories; and BASHNATCH. The backdoor was dropped via PowerShell from attacker-controlled Backblaze B2 storage and supports screenshots, webcam capture, file listing, downloads, and shell command execution.

CISA Warns Hackers Exploit 17 Active Directory Techniques to Gain Control of Enterprise Networks

CISA and Five Eyes agencies issued joint guidance detailing 17 Active Directory attack techniques like Kerberoasting and DCSync, with hardening and detection advice.

CISA, the NSA, and cyber agencies from Australia, Canada, the UK, and New Zealand released joint guidance on September 15 covering 17 techniques attackers use to compromise Active Directory, including AD CS, Certificate Services, and Federation Services attacks. Named techniques include Kerberoasting, AS-REP roasting, password spraying, DCSync, NTDS.dit dumping, Golden and Silver Tickets, Golden SAML, and Skeleton Key. Recommendations include minimizing SPN accounts, enforcing AES encryption, disabling NTLM, account lockout thresholds of five attempts, phishing-resistant MFA, and Tier 0 prioritization. The guide also lists Windows event IDs 4769, 4768, 4625, 4771, and 2889 for detecting Kerberoasting and password spraying on domain controllers.

America's Driver's License Breach Is a National Security Disaster

Dark web service Nexus sells 153 million US/Canadian driver's licenses linked to a breach of identity verifier IDScan.

Krebs on Security revealed a dark web service, Nexus, selling access to 153 million driver's licenses and 3 million travel documents from US and Canadian citizens, roughly 63 percent of all US licenses. Circumstantial evidence links the data to identity verification firm IDScan, which confirmed it is investigating a breach, and the FBI is probing the incident. Licenses belonging to senior US officials, including Pete Hegseth, an FBI assistant director, and Krebs's own contacts were verified as genuine. The exfiltration appears ongoing, with the database growing by nearly 400,000 licenses in a single day, and the data carries significant national security value for foreign intelligence services.

Siemens Reyrolle 7SR5

CISA advisory covers 14 vulnerabilities, CVSS 9.8, in Siemens Reyrolle 7SR5 energy-sector protection relays before V2.70.

CISA advisory ICSA-26-258-05 covers 14 vulnerabilities in Siemens Reyrolle 7SR5 protection relays before V2.70, used in the energy sector worldwide, with aggregate CVSS v3 of 9.8. Flaws include Cesanta Mongoose web server issues (CVE-2024-42384 through CVE-2024-42392) and new bugs such as web-interface session-ID exposure enabling authentication bypass (CVE-2026-62645, CVSS 9.8), predictable session tokens (CVE-2026-62646, CVE-2026-62647), and pre-auth out-of-bounds writes (CVE-2026-62648). Siemens has released V2.70 and recommends updating to the latest version.
